#6b231b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6b231b is composed of 42% red, 13.7%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.3% magenta, 74.8%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 6 degrees, a saturation of 59.7% and a lightness of 26.3%. #6b231b color hex could be obtained by blending #d64636 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#6b231b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0403 is the darkest color, while #fefd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b231b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#47403f is the less saturated color, while #850e01 is the most saturated one.
